Chip123 科技應用創新平台

 找回密碼
 申請會員

QQ登錄

只需一步,快速開始

Login

用FB帳號登入

搜索
1 2 3 4
查看: 16454|回復: 11
打印 上一主題 下一主題

CALIBRE LVS & DRC

  [複製鏈接]
跳轉到指定樓層
1#
發表於 2008-3-5 17:33:06 | 只看該作者 回帖獎勵 |倒序瀏覽 |閱讀模式
請問一下有誰大概可以跟我描述一下 LVS 跟 DRC 一些基本的概念!!  J- T( h! O9 s
4 e( R% u5 H6 m
比如說怎麼去認一個NET DRC怎麼比對的呢? 比較內部的分析
% y" @" d6 v3 n8 V: m1 _
" g1 I* _( t" b- H! l謝謝分享...
分享到:  QQ好友和群QQ好友和群 QQ空間QQ空間 騰訊微博騰訊微博 騰訊朋友騰訊朋友
收藏收藏 分享分享 頂4 踩 分享分享
2#
發表於 2008-3-6 17:35:09 | 只看該作者
極簡單的說DRC 就是Design Rule Check 的縮寫,也就是依照Design Rule來check你畫的layout
1 p+ \- ~/ U6 |: F( B( T只要將check 出來的error部份修除就ok了
7 n% }5 m4 H6 z
. a) ]5 K  e( }- G% I) V極簡單的說LVS 就是Layout vs Schematic 意思就是layout跟電路的比對
( v, U  r0 ?, |' C1 G8 k* t除了比對電路有沒有接錯還會比對model有沒有畫錯。
* t) R6 E+ N- N: D4 r- @+ s* ?& G7 B& B' \2 d  D
另外請問您的問題NET DRC 是什麼意思?因為沒看過所以沒辦法給你解答。
3#
 樓主| 發表於 2008-3-6 18:30:07 | 只看該作者
喔 不好意思 我沒有逗號逗開 我的意思是說 lvs 是用什麼樣的原理去比對... 他樣去認出一顆mos 或是 inv 呢??! E! `% {7 {" X
3 Z' C' B& K4 x3 A) ?( R# n2 v2 r- ]
那他怎麼去認出 那根NET 要跟哪個NET相接 SPICE上寫的NET 他怎麼去判斷的呢!?
; T/ @: \1 z7 @8 c) g- ^1 a; X. h7 v3 b0 v3 _
是這個意思拉...DRC也是  他比對DRC時 是怎樣比對 一層一層 或是用座標 之類的 相關資訊 ^^( q5 y! n4 ^/ C6 K2 s4 t
* i: X0 a: n) h
謝謝你
4#
發表於 2008-3-7 08:53:44 | 只看該作者
簡單的說~你要的答案可以在LVS & DRC 的COMMAND裡找到; y7 F- D/ i, F6 u6 O
; Z: b0 b6 o8 T$ a
LVS的原理就跟之前所說的一樣,CALIBRE 如何去認到MOS 除了COMMAND外3 n2 C6 D5 f1 b( J2 k! b
你還必須STREAM IN SPICE ,COMMAND裡會去定義怎樣的條件下他是PMOS3 q! I7 [# F7 e. b1 N) Z# M! A
還是NMOS,如何判定是INV是去比對你所STREAM IN 的SPICE ,在LAYOUT中
" H2 W' A* M8 D& p" `如果有PMOS 跟NMOS的連接方式跟SPICE中的定義相同那LAYOUT就是INV,至
3 {, P; o" B4 b. Y2 u於如何找到特定的NET,除非在電路中就事先寫入,不然在CALIBRE RUN LVS時
+ T3 d' m$ N  w. Y所產生的NET NAME是隨機排序的,不過有些LAYOUT的TOOL有辦法認到NET,3 z7 ]4 ^6 x7 Z* Z+ c. M* h+ y! U
但也是必須事先設定。
  B8 K1 z  G& e; W0 w  t; \/ i0 {; W* z$ b
DRC的原也跟之前說的一樣,COMMAND FILE 會去依DESIGN RUN 裡的規則然/ E. \! S+ F' u
後寫出一連串的句子,將所有層的可能的相對關係以條件式的方式寫入,然後再
# B6 w0 y/ W1 T9 R2 k/ k利用TOOL 去比對並將結果顯示。, a2 ]( x: Q6 }3 X4 Z

+ \! S, K4 F6 A以上是我所了解的部份,希望有幫你解答到。
5#
發表於 2008-3-10 17:05:44 | 只看該作者
學了一年多,現在才在這裡看到原來是這樣的縮寫,以前都只會用,但不知道有這樣的意義所在,真是受益良多阿!!
6#
發表於 2008-3-13 22:26:06 | 只看該作者
大大的解釋真好~~~小弟了解囉~~多謝唷~~多謝你的無私~~謝謝
7#
發表於 2008-4-25 03:03:52 | 只看該作者
我看我看我看看看3 n2 U1 ?8 l# U: D8 }
我看我看我看看看  i# e& J% g1 J: \
我看我看我看看看
# ^5 z9 U3 t' H; A) F我看我看我看看看
/ c  n8 t/ [4 Z/ o& {" ?( U( D我看我看我看看看
8#
發表於 2008-4-28 09:42:49 | 只看該作者

回復 7# 的帖子

請問一下大大們/ \" |$ B8 p# ]# d3 ^' l
要跑lvs時. \) ^5 }1 S1 Y
要產生.sp檔一直發生錯誤1 Z6 v$ P4 m1 D, W
沒辦法成功% C3 t6 U# _+ W4 ?
請問是甚麼問題阿
9#
發表於 2008-7-24 00:18:11 | 只看該作者
我看我看我看看看
* H6 l* ?0 R& n. ?我看我看我看看看
+ l$ M, q" g8 z4 [) }, J" k我看我看我看看看* `  ], E. h2 A; X7 q# Q; A, V2 i- c
我看我看我看看看
, e0 O  ~$ n, n% D& K我看我看我看看看
10#
發表於 2008-7-30 20:15:50 | 只看該作者
請問一下大大們
9 g! {0 e9 h9 C, Q要跑lvs時
: F5 R8 {+ _8 s  Q要產生.sp檔一直發生錯誤. W/ G% H$ J) U( i; @' _
沒辦法成功
5 m* F6 }$ T1 j8 X0 V  c% j請問是甚麼問題阿3 ?, I7 C. r- r
*************+ a* v$ j3 a' X! ?1 [2 y4 A& F
可以將問題敘述更詳細一點嗎?9 F- A4 e  Y3 C5 j
這樣才可以確切的解決大大的困擾~
11#
發表於 2008-7-30 21:38:23 | 只看該作者
請問一下大大們
2 o$ _  Q# T) u1 B6 }( R, B$ W要跑lvs時
# ]1 i' {3 s- @' N2 Z* W- w要產生.sp檔一直發生錯誤
* }% o" `/ v. w, n' F0 w沒辦法成功! v6 w9 i/ Q3 Y6 L4 p
請問是甚麼問題阿
1 L- N( l! _; V: k) @*************
/ y" _1 g1 V4 W2 i" a  _' @
+ p+ M5 d; s' i9 F0 }不管執行什麼程式,都會記錄在紀錄檔裡,例如: *.log,
+ @- R$ E& @+ n你先開 *.log 看看是什麼原因?
8 Q, _, s/ X# E
12#
發表於 2020-8-16 11:08:17 | 只看該作者
大的解釋真好~~~小弟了解囉~~多謝唷~~多謝你的無私~~謝謝
您需要登錄後才可以回帖 登錄 | 申請會員

本版積分規則

首頁|手機版|Chip123 科技應用創新平台 |新契機國際商機整合股份有限公司

GMT+8, 2024-5-30 10:48 AM , Processed in 0.141018 second(s), 18 queries .

Powered by Discuz! X3.2

© 2001-2013 Comsenz Inc.

快速回復 返回頂部 返回列表